Create a Functional Layout
Arrange your outdoor bar furniture in a layout that maximizes space and facilitates social interaction. Position the bar table and stools in a central location, allowing guests to gather around and mingle comfortably. Consider adding additional seating options such as lounge chairs or outdoor sofas for guests to relax and enjoy the ambiance.
Stock the Bar with Essentials
Equip your outdoor bar area with essential barware, glassware, and beverage options to cater to your guests' preferences. Stock the bar with a variety of spirits, mixers, garnishes, and non-alcoholic beverages to accommodate different tastes and preferences. Provide ample ice, cocktail shakers, and bar tools to facilitate drink preparation and service.

Provide Comfortable Seating and Shade
Ensure that your outdoor bar area offers comfortable seating options and adequate shade to keep guests cool and comfortable during outdoor gatherings. Invest in cushioned bar stools, lounge chairs, or outdoor benches with weather-resistant upholstery for added comfort. Consider adding umbrellas, awnings, or pergolas to provide shade and protection from the sun.

Encourage Outdoor Games and Activities
Keep guests entertained with outdoor games and activities that add fun and excitement to your patio gatherings. Set up a cornhole toss, bocce ball, or horseshoe pit for friendly competition and interactive entertainment. Provide board games, playing cards, or lawn games for guests of all ages to enjoy.
